Java/Scala Developer

Why should you join us?

We know that geniuses are not born in one place, so we are ready to offer a generous relocation package that includes costs with the accommodation, luggage transport, personal transport and real estate assistance. Digital Readiness stands for the capability of Metro to deliver outstanding digital solutions on a global scale instantaneously. Customer Data Management (CDM) is the fundament of the new Customer Master Data Management solution. You will be part of a distributed team of technical experts focused on developing the new Metro solution for managing customer information for multichannel services. As a software development engineer you will develop full stack applications that will enable real-time access to reliable customer information for all customer facing channels. You will leverage the newest technology stacks to build modern distributed systems used worldwide by Metro customers. Successful candidates will be innovative, passionate, flexible and able to design and write high-performance, reliable, maintainable code.

What we’re looking for?

  • Has hands-on expertise in many disparate technologies, typically ranging from front-end user interfaces through to back-end systems and all points in between
  • Has experience in developing large-scale distributed systems
  • Is comfortable with collaboration, open communication and reaching across functional borders
  • Will focus on lowering the time between having ideas and making stuff happen

You’re a great fit if you have:

  • Fluency in Java acquired in 2+ years of development experience. Experience with Spring is highly desired.
  • Scala knowledge
  • Good knowledge of data structures and algorithms
  • Good knowledge of JavaScript frameworks, React preferred
  • Experience of working with “NoSQL” solutions such as Cassandra.
  • Experience building REST APIs, using JSON and Swagger
  • Have experience/knowledge of microservices and Docker container technology managed with Kubernetes;
  • Are familiar with real-time data streaming and processing technologies like akka, Spark, Kafka.
  • Have the ability to communicate with users and other technical teams;
  • Have a systematic problem solving approach, coupled with a strong sense of ownership and drive;
  • Have a good sense of humor;
  • Are always thinking, “What happens if this fails?”.
  • Can work independently and is self-motivated but thrives as part of a team;
  • Have a good command of English.

What we offer?

  • Opportunity to learn and work with a variety of technologies
  • Career programs
  • Multicultural, Agile environment that encourages new ideas and innovation
  • Flexible working hours
  • Lunch tickets
  • Medical subscription and life insurance
  • Private pension
  • Fitness centers discounts, sports activities and other company events
  • Good transport connections and free parking
  • Relaxation area (ping pong, foosball, massage)
  • Free account
  • And…fresh orange juice, good coffee, fresh fruits.


Location: Brasov

Apply now


Privacy Policy for Applicants

For information about the processing of your personal data and your rights in this processing please visit our "data privacy for applicants".